Hollingworth is a charming village nestled on the edge of the Peak District, offering the perfect balance between rural tranquility and urban accessibility. With its close-knit community, scenic surroundings, and excellent transport links, including easy access to the M67 and nearby train stations, it's an ideal location for commuters and families alike. The village benefits from local shops, reputable schools, countryside walks, and a welcoming atmosphere, making it a sought-after place to call home.
